Aspiring data professionals often encounter two distinct roles: Data Analyst and Data Scientist. While both work with data to extract insights, their responsibilities, skill sets, and impact on decision-making differ significantly. Many organisations, including those in HealthTech, are increasingly relying on and managing big data to create solutions that are personalised, reliable and capable of executing complex tasks. Data is crucial in informing strategic decisions and optimising operations, with both structured and unstructured data used in training input and identifying gaps.
This article unpacks the distinctions and similarities between the Data Analyst and Data Scientist roles, essential skills and certifications required, as well as the possible career progression paths.
Overview of Data Analyst and Data Scientist Roles
Data Analyst
Data Analysts help business teams answer questions and make decisions based on data. They gather information from different sources, prepare it for analysis, and share their findings through reports and dashboards. Analysts often work with tools such as SQL, Excel, Tableau, and Power BI to support their work. In healthcare, for example, an Analyst might help doctors and administrators understand how different treatments impact patient outcomes.
Data Scientist
Data Scientists build on traditional data analysis by developing predictive models and applying machine learning techniques to forecast trends and automate decision-making. They work with both structured (e.g. spreadsheets, databases) and unstructured data (e.g. text, images), using tools such as Python, R, TensorFlow, and Hadoop. Their expertise is essential across sectors like technology, research, and e-commerce. For example, a Data Scientist at an online retailer might create a recommendation system that suggests products based on a user’s browsing behaviour and purchase history.
Shared Foundational Skills
Statistical Analysis
Both Data Analysts and Data Scientists work with statistics. However, their approach can differ. Analysts often focus on understanding past performance, identifying patterns in historical data that help explain what happened. Scientists use statistical and machine learning models to explore potential outcomes or test how different actions might influence future events. For instance, a company might model how changes in pricing could affect customer retention.
Data Visualisation
The ability to present data insights through visual tools is crucial for transforming raw data into meaningful narratives that support strategic decision-making, highlight key trends, and ensure that both technical and non-technical stakeholders can easily grasp complex information.
Data Analysts create dashboards and reports to communicate findings to business stakeholders. Data Scientists use visualisations to explain complex models and findings to technical and non-technical audiences. Analysts and Scientists rely on visualisation tools to make complex data easier to understand.
For example, in a healthtech setting, they might create dashboards that track patient admission trends, monitor chronic disease management outcomes, or visualise how different digital health interventions impact patient engagement over time.
SQL Proficiency
Structured Query Language (SQL) is a programming language that organisations use to store, organise, extract and manipulate data from relational databases, which are large datasets that come in a tabular format. Together with Python, they are the two most used languages in data science work
Data Analysts typically use SQL for routine data retrieval and reporting, while Data Scientists often use it as part of a broader data pipeline for machine learning workflows. For example, a Data Scientist might write SQL queries to extract training data for a machine learning model.
Communication Skills
Clear communication is a vital part of working with data. Analysts and Scientists need to explain their findings in ways that decision-makers can use—whether through a written summary, a dashboard, or a face-to-face discussion. The goal is to help business teams understand their findings and demonstrate how they meet the business team’s requirements.
Distinct Skills of Data Analysts
1. Business Acumen
The best data analysts are skilled “diplomats” as they can navigate seamlessly between the technical world and the boardroom. A good Data Analyst must understand both the organisation's business requirements and how to manage its data. Being well-versed in business needs will help Data Analysts produce more targeted and valuable findings. It's the difference between providing answers to questions nobody asked versus delivering insights that actually move the needle.
For example, in Synapxe's Data Analytics and AI Department, a group of analysts working on a machine learning project is responsible for testing, identifying and gathering data to ensure that it can accurately detect objects and conduct pattern recognition. Such research could be applied in solutions such as those for remotely monitoring whether patients are taking their medications or performing rehabilitation exercises correctly.
2. Dashboard Creation
Every successful organisation needs its mission control, a place where all the vital signs are monitored in real time. For example, dashboards give business teams a convenient way to keep track of the organisation's progress and requirements. The dashboard is also useful for the finance team to conduct regular reviews, spotting shifts in revenue, or expenses as they occur. Behind the scenes, Analysts set up these dashboards using tools like Tableau or Power BI to ensure the information stays current. It's like having a pulse on your organisation's health, with analysts working as skilled technicians keeping all the monitors running smoothly.
3. Reporting
Having raw data is like having all the ingredients for a gourmet meal, but no recipe – everything you need is there, but it's not particularly useful until someone puts it together. Data Analysts need to create comprehensive reports to help business teams stay on top of trends that affect the industry and organisation. Important data points need to be extracted and synthesised into a coherent data-story that is relevant to the ever-changing industry landscape. This report will then be useful for the organisation to make quick and informed decisions. A report may include key information about the project, the rationale for how the data is processed and organised, or why the organisation needs to provide investment to drive projects forward. It is about transforming scattered insights into a compelling narrative that guides strategic thinking.
4. Data Cleaning
Before Data Analysts can find meaningful insights, they need to clean up messy raw data. This means finding and fixing common problems like duplicate entries, missing information, spelling mistakes, and formatting inconsistencies.
Data cleaning is essential because even the best analysis will give wrong answers if the underlying data is flawed. Clean, accurate data forms the foundation for reliable insights and sound decision-making, which becomes even more critical as organisations increasingly rely on AI and automated tools.
5. Use of BI Tools
Business intelligence (BI) tools like Power BI and Tableau help Analysts turn complex datasets into clear, actionable insights. They transform rows of numbers into interactive dashboards, dynamic charts, and intuitive reports that make even the most intricate patterns easily understandable to anyone in the organisation.
These platforms give Data Analysts the power and flexibility. to dive straight into the data and create polished presentations, instead of relying external data management support.
Distinct Skills of Data Scientists
1. Machine Learning
Data Scientists with deep knowledge of machine learning and deep learning are able to efficiently gather and synthesise data, allowing them to spot patterns you never knew existed and predict future trends. These analytical wizards can leverage their strong mathematics and statistics skills to build and implement algorithms to that ensure their AI-driven initiatives produce reliable results, transforming what seems like chaos into clear, actionable insights.
2. Programming Expertise
Programming languages have transformed how we approach complex data challenges. Data Scientists have advanced coding skills in languages like Python and R, allowing them to write programs and algorithms to automate calculations and data processing. Think of it as teaching computers to do the heavy lifting whilst you focus on the bigger picture. These languages offer powerful libraries for data manipulation (Pandas, dplyr), machine learning (Scikit-learn, TensorFlow), and data visualisation (Matplotlib, ggplot2), essentially giving data scientists a fully equipped toolkit . The programming knowledge will also support collaboration with IT architect teams, data engineers and software developers to create reliable solutions according to an organisation's needs.
3. Big Data Handling and Database Management
Data Scientists need to clean and organise large, complex datasets using tools such as Hadoop and Spark.. enabling easier access to and analysis of data. Furthermore, Data Scientists need to search and extract data from various sources, both within the organisation and externally, and transform it into a format suitable for submitting queries and conducting analysis.
4. Model Deployment
Model deployment is when the machine learning model finally goes live and starts working with real data in production systems. It's the bridge between development and actual use, where the model becomes available to end users and other applications.
A Data Scientist needs to be familiar with model deployment as it is a key milestone that comes after collecting data, building and training the model, and evaluating its performance.,
Model deployment approaches and methods can differ according to the organisation’s established IT systems and any software development and operations (DevOps) procedures; hence, a Data Scientist’s ability to adapt is an added advantage.
5. Research Skills
Data Scientist need to think like researchers, approaching problems by forming clear hypotheses, designing proper experiments, and drawing conclusions based on solid evidence rather than assumptions.
For example, a Data Scientist developing a new pricing algorithm would run controlled experiments, like A/B tests, to see how different prices affect customer behaviour and sales. This systematic approach helps distinguish real patterns from random coincidences in the data.
Comparative Table: Data Analyst vs Data Scientist Skills
| Skill Area | Data Analyst | Data Scientist |
| Statistical Analysis | Descriptive statistics |
Predictive modelling |
| Tools | Excel, DQL, Tableau | Python, R, Tensorflow |
| Data Handling | Structured Data | Structured and unstructured data |
| Focus | Historical Data | Future predictions |
| Reporting | Regular business reports | Research papers model, documentation |